Somerset County Housing Authority Directory

Somerset County, New Jersey has 3 housing authorities managing 490 Section 8 vouchers. 3 currently have open waiting lists.

Somerset County's housing market is predominantly suburban, characterized by high property values and a significant cost-of-living that strains the budgets of many residents, particularly those in lower-wage service and essential worker roles who often require rental assistance. The demand for affordable housing is driven by the need to keep these vital community members housed within the county, despite the economic pressures that make it challenging for them to afford market-rate rents.

Section 8 Payment Standards: Somerset County

HUD FY2026 Fair Market Rents: the maximum a voucher covers per month:

Studio
$1,804
per month
1 Bedroom
$1,978
per month
2 Bedroom
$2,486
per month
3 Bedroom
$2,981
per month
4 Bedroom
$3,296
per month

Source: HUD Fair Market Rents 2026 · huduser.gov

The federal Fair Housing Act prohibits discrimination in housing because of race, color, national origin, religion, familial status, gender, and disability. The Fair Housing Act ensures that all persons receive equal housing opportunity.
